ruddier
Adjective
/ˈrʌdiər/

Definition
Having a reddish or rosy color.

Examples
- The sunset painted the sky a ruddier shade of orange and pink.
- After the workout, her cheeks were ruddier than usual.
- The autumn leaves turned ruddier as the season progressed.

Meaning
The term ‘ruddier’ is used to describe someone or something that has a more intense red or rosy hue. It can refer to skin tone, especially when someone becomes flushed or when referring to natural phenomena.
